What is a transgender hair transplant?
A transgender hair transplant adapts surgical hair restoration to gender-affirming goals. That may mean feminising a hairline and temples, restoring density that supports your presentation, or building framing that feels aligned with your identity rather than a default male-pattern template.
Design differs from standard restoration. Hairline height, roundness, temple softness and density distribution are shaped around affirming aesthetics and your facial features. Trans women often seek lower, softer frontal lines. Trans men may focus on temporal recession or density that supports a masculine frame. Non-binary patients may want a neutral or customised shape discussed openly in Consultation.

Hormone therapy, age of transition and existing hair loss pattern can all influence timing and results. We take medical history into account and discuss how graft growth follows the same biological timeline as any FUE procedure.

Feminising, masculinising and personalised hairline goals.
Gender-affirming hair restoration is as much design artistry as surgical technique. A feminising plan often focuses on rounding the frontal line, softening temple recessions and lowering the hairline within donor limits. Masculinising goals may emphasise temporal peaks, density through the frontal zone or coverage that supports shorter styles.
We use photography and mirror planning so you can see the proposed shape before surgery. The aim is framing that reads naturally with your features, not an exaggerated or age-inappropriate line.
- Feminising lines: softer curves, lower frontal edge where donor allows, temple integration
- Masculinising framing: temporal restoration and density that supports your presentation
- Non-binary goals: open discussion of shape, height and density without preset templates
- Age-appropriate planning: lines that suit your face now and over time
Hormones, hair behaviour and when to plan surgery.
Hormone therapy can influence hair growth, shedding and how existing native hair behaves. That does not automatically rule out transplant, but it informs timing and expectations. We review your history and any ongoing medical care at Consultation.
Some patients plan surgery alongside facial feminisation or masculinisation procedures. When that applies, we discuss sequencing so healing and design stay coherent across your wider transition plan.
- Share hormone history and any medications affecting hair or healing
- Discuss whether loss is still actively changing before committing to surgery
- Plan around other procedures when timing affects design or recovery
- Set realistic expectations for how grafts mature over months, not days
What to expect on procedure day.
Gender-affirming FUE at our Regent Street clinic is usually completed in one day under local anaesthetic. Frontal and temple work often needs meticulous single-hair placement at the leading edge, which takes time and precision.
You remain awake and comfortable. After donor harvest and graft preparation, placement follows the angles and density map agreed in your design Consultation.
- Arrive as instructed for hair washing and any pre-visit guidance
- Plan a few days of lighter social activity while visible healing settles
- Avoid strenuous exercise, swimming and direct sun during early aftercare
- Follow the written aftercare sheet; contact us with any concerns about pain or redness

Transplanted hairs shed in the first weeks, then regrow over months. Follow-up reviews track healing and maturation so you know what is normal at each stage.
- Confidential Consultation: private setting on Regent Street with respectful communication
- Shedding phase: normal in weeks 2-6; new growth begins around month three
- Maturation: visible framing improvement builds through months six to twelve

Affirming FUE vs generic hairline FUE vs non-surgical options
Use this table when you are choosing a pathway for gender-affirming hair restoration. We plan around your identity and donor reality, not a default male-pattern script.
| Factor | Affirming FUE | Generic hairline FUE | Wigs / hair systems | Medical / regenerative |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Best for | Identity-led hairline and temple goals with suitable donor | Standard recession patterns without gender-specific design | Immediate cosmetic change without surgery | Thinning where follicles still respond and surgery is not yet right |
| Design focus | Feminising, masculinising or personalised framing | Typical male-pattern templates | Style choice; no surgical hairline change | Supports native hair; does not reshape hairline with grafts |
| Permanence | Living donor hair; long-term growth after maturation | Same surgical permanence if design fits your goals | Requires ongoing maintenance and replacement | Not permanent density replacement in bare zones |
| Privacy | Discreet clinic Consultation and local follow-up | Same clinic setting; design may not match affirming goals | Private day to day; no surgical result | Clinic sessions; no hairline grafting |
| When we say no | When donor cannot support the affirming design brief | When a generic plan would not meet your presentation goals | When you want permanent hair growth at the hairline | When follicles are gone and surgery is the realistic option |

What is a transgender hair transplant?
Hair restoration designed around gender-affirming aesthetics, such as a softer rounded hairline, temple restoration or density that supports your presentation. Design intent differs from standard male-pattern plans.
Do hormones affect transplant timing?
They can influence hair behaviour and healing context. We take hormone history into account when planning timing and expectations. Active rapid change in loss pattern may suggest waiting before surgery.
Can you feminise a masculine hairline?
Often yes, by reshaping temples and frontal contours with careful graft placement, within donor limits. We explain honestly what lowering and rounding can achieve for your face and donor supply.
Is the procedure technically different?
Core FUE skills are similar. The differentiator is affirming design: height, curve, temple integration and density distribution planned for your goals rather than a generic template.

How long until affirming results show?
The same biological timeline as other FUE procedures: shedding in the first weeks, new growth from around month three, visible framing improvement by months six to nine, and mature results near twelve months.
